Event Details

Description

Disney Shabbat is coming! ✨🏰

Join us for a magical family evening with:
🕯️ Traditional Shabbat blessings set to Disney tunes
🍽️ Kid-friendly dinner & dessert
🎨 Disney-themed activities & special treats

Friday, March 13th | 5:30-7:30pm
$36 per family | RSVP by March 10th
